Faultless Caster: Morgan Stacking Dolly
By Faultless Caster 
March 16, 2014

The Morgan stacking dolly by Faultless Caster makes moving and storage of 800-pound loads easier.

Weighing only 14 pounds, each dolly features durable, 1-inch plywood construction on hard rubber wheel casters, and carpeted legs for spill-, slip- and scuff-free use. When not in use, up to 35 dollies can be stacked into a single, 40-inch high column that moves as a single unit and takes up minimal space.

Compact and interlocking, the dollies feature a built-in handgrip for easy carrying and stacking. They can be stacked wheels-down for moving, and wheels-up for trucking.
